Address

QjfzF85tq1QSu23PhjYWf9BBmUF7tDm6dYCopy

Total Received

33691.12934395 QTUM

Total Sent

33691.12934395 QTUM

№ Transactions

101

Final Balance

0 QTUM

Transactions
Filter